Core Insights - Ingredion Incorporated reported solid second quarter results for 2025, highlighting the strength of its diversified business model, with significant growth in the Texture & Healthful Solutions segment [2][5][10] Financial Performance - Reported diluted EPS for Q2 2025 was $2.99, up 35% from $2.22 in Q2 2024, while adjusted diluted EPS remained stable at $2.87 [3][5] - Total net sales for Q2 2025 decreased by 2% to $1.833 billion, primarily due to lower volume and price mix, despite growth in the Texture & Healthful Solutions segment [10][43] - Reported operating income increased by 13% to $271 million, while adjusted operating income rose by 1% to $273 million compared to the previous year [11][44] Segment Performance - The Texture & Healthful Solutions segment achieved a 2% increase in net sales to $599 million and a 29% rise in operating income to $111 million, driven by lower raw material costs and increased volumes [14][15] - Food & Industrial Ingredients—LATAM saw a 5% decline in net sales to $596 million, with operating income decreasing by 2% to $127 million, impacted by foreign exchange rates and joint venture performance [16][17] - The U.S./Canada segment experienced a 6% drop in net sales to $523 million, with operating income down 18% to $86 million, primarily due to a mechanical fire affecting production [18][20] Guidance and Outlook - The company updated its full-year 2025 guidance, expecting reported EPS in the range of $11.25 to $11.75 and adjusted EPS between $11.10 and $11.60 [25][26] - Full-year net sales are anticipated to be flat, with mid-single-digit growth expected for both reported and adjusted operating income [26][27] - The Texture & Healthful Solutions segment is projected to see low double-digit growth in operating income, while the U.S./Canada segment is expected to decline slightly [27][28]
